It's really a book!



I'm amazed that people have posted about already receiving Hamlet.  The earliest
ones were mailed out on Friday, 4th class book rate. If anyone received it on 
Monday it probably made for a fine April Fool's Day gift.  Of course, I'm 
partial to April 2nd as well. Yesterday was the ninth anniversary of my doctoral
defense, and I can't think of a nicer anniversary gift to give myself than 
Hamlet.

Thank you to all of you have said such kind and generous things about the book. 
I of course agree with all of it.  ;)

I can take credit for only a small portion of it, the real praise should go to 
the translators Nick Nicholas and Andrew (Guido) Strader, and to the editors 
Mark Shoulson, Will Martin, and d'Armond Speers.  And to Sarah Ekstrom as well, 
KSRP Coordinator.  These are the people who brought you Hamlet, praise them with
great praise!
